#e87290 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e87290 is composed of 91% red, 44.7%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.9% magenta, 37.9%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 344.7 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 67.8%. #e87290 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#d10021.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#e87290

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0204 is the darkest color, while #fef9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e87290

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afabac is the less saturated color, while #fb5f87 is the most saturated one.
